George E. Donahue, Jr.

George E. Donahue, Jr., 77, of DuBois, PA, died Wednesday, July 21, 2021 at the DuBois Nursing Home.

Born on August 10, 1943 in DuBois, PA, he was the son of the late George E. and Kathryn (Neeper) Donahue, Sr.

George graduated from the DuBois High School and was a veteran of the United States Air Force.

On August 17, 1963 at St. Peter’s United Church of Christ, he married his wife of 57 years, Karen A. (Boring) Donahue. She survives.

George retired from Gasbarre Products Pressed Division and previous to that he spent most of his life in law enforcement.

He was a past member of the Sandy Hose Company #1, was a member of the George D. Montgomery American Legion Post 17, enjoyed camping and above all, spending time with his family.

George is also survived by his children, Brian Donahue, Bradley Donahue and his wife Barb, Jim Donahue & his wife Cathy, all of DuBois, PA, George E. Donahue III and his husband Felix Torres of Charlotte, NC and Sue Anne Pridgen and her husband Charles of Rocky Mount, NC. He is also survived by three brothers, Lance, Russell and Fred Donahue; son-in-law John Shaffer; four grandchildren, three step-grandchildren, and four great-gr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by his daughter Mary Shaffer.
